Is there an app or way to browse a directory that requires different login credentials without using a mapped drive?

The issue is given one login credential Windows Explorer only allows you to map it to one drive and disallows using the same login credential to map to a different drive.

    That’s simply not true…you can authenticate with the same login credentials to multiple servers. What you can’t do is:

    • Be automatically authenticated to the 2nd server
    • Connect to the same server with different credentials

    My understanding is that the reason for both problems is that Windows stores the credentials by server name.
